三分钟快速部署DeepSeek R1,轻松上手本地化应用

作者:谁偷走了我的奶酪2025.03.11 03:03浏览量:31

简介:本文详细介绍了如何在三分钟内本地部署DeepSeek R1,即使是技术小白也能轻松上手。文章从环境准备、安装步骤到常见问题解决,提供了全面的操作指南,帮助读者快速实现本地化应用。

文心大模型4.5及X1 正式发布

百度智能云千帆全面支持文心大模型4.5 API调用,文心大模型X1即将上线

立即体验

三分钟快速部署DeepSeek R1,轻松上手本地化应用

在当今快速发展的技术环境中,本地化部署成为了许多开发者和企业用户的重要需求。DeepSeek R1作为一款高效的工具,其本地化部署过程简单快捷,即使是技术小白也能在三分钟内完成。本文将详细指导您如何实现这一目标,确保您能够轻松上手本地化应用。

一、环境准备

在开始部署之前,确保您的本地环境满足以下基本要求:

  1. 操作系统:DeepSeek R1支持Windows、macOS和Linux系统。请确保您的操作系统版本是最新的,以避免兼容性问题。
  2. Python环境:DeepSeek R1基于Python开发,因此需要安装Python 3.7及以上版本。您可以通过以下命令检查Python版本:
    1. python --version
  3. 依赖库:DeepSeek R1依赖于一些常见的Python库,如NumPy、Pandas等。您可以通过以下命令安装这些依赖库:
    1. pip install numpy pandas
  4. Git:如果您计划从GitHub仓库克隆DeepSeek R1的源码,请确保已安装Git。您可以通过以下命令检查Git是否已安装:
    1. git --version

二、安装步骤

  1. 克隆仓库:首先,从GitHub克隆DeepSeek R1的源码到本地。打开终端,运行以下命令:
    1. git clone https://github.com/deepseek/R1.git
  2. 进入目录:克隆完成后,进入DeepSeek R1的目录:
    1. cd R1
  3. 安装依赖:在DeepSeek R1的目录中,运行以下命令安装所有依赖库:
    1. pip install -r requirements.txt
  4. 运行程序:依赖安装完成后,您可以通过以下命令启动DeepSeek R1:
    1. python main.py

三、常见问题及解决方案

  1. Python版本不兼容:如果您的Python版本低于3.7,请升级到最新版本。您可以通过以下命令升级Python:

    1. brew upgrade python

    (适用于macOS)

  2. 依赖库安装失败:如果某些依赖库安装失败,可以尝试手动安装这些库。例如,手动安装NumPy:

    1. pip install numpy
  3. 程序启动失败:如果程序启动失败,请检查是否有其他程序占用了相同的端口。您可以通过以下命令查看端口占用情况:

    1. lsof -i :5000

    (假设DeepSeek R1使用5000端口)

四、深度扩展

  1. 自定义配置:DeepSeek R1允许用户通过修改配置文件来定制化部署。您可以在config.ini文件中调整参数,如数据库连接、API密钥等。

  2. 集成其他服务:DeepSeek R1支持与其他服务的集成,如Docker、Kubernetes等。您可以通过Dockerfile将DeepSeek R1打包成容器,实现更灵活的部署方式。

  3. 性能优化:对于需要更高性能的场景,您可以考虑使用多线程或多进程技术来优化DeepSeek R1的运行效率。Python的multiprocessing模块可以帮助您实现这一目标。

五、总结

通过以上步骤,您可以在三分钟内完成DeepSeek R1的本地化部署。即使是技术小白,也能轻松上手。本文不仅提供了详细的安装指南,还针对常见问题给出了解决方案,并介绍了如何进行深度扩展和性能优化。希望本文能帮助您快速实现本地化应用,提升开发效率。

如果您在部署过程中遇到任何问题,欢迎在评论区留言,我们将尽快为您解答。

article bottom image
图片